Transaction 64c5381cb568afc09baa92f0b3bfbfb3296af7e0cbf87aa7afea14a916b1dcf3
1 Input
1 Output
-
64c5381cb568afc09baa92f0b3bfbfb3296af7e0cbf87aa7afea14a916b1dcf3:0
- value
- 1491576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a681763076f5daff118391280d447d4f9b60e8f2 OP_EQUAL
- address
- 3GsRBYRcw1ugnxntGnRvA4iZFSF7aYWJYB